A man and three teenagers have been charged following reports of criminal damage to a number of cars.

Darren Ridings, 21, of Green Fold Lane, Westhoughton, has been charged with three counts of damage to a motor vehicle.

He will next be appearing in court on January 16, 2024.

In addition, two 16-year-old males and a 15-year-old male, who can't be named for legal reasons, have been charged with causing criminal damage to three vehicles.
